Output e96509b607e707f262d526d46b06750125da2e5795ae58ae1add9ab8fa4bc495:0

value
3857426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7db55fe4c68793122d4dc9ab7a1042baa3f38be OP_EQUALVERIFY OP_CHECKSIG
address
1N8wr3GduAKXpnh3BNsEpqxuvzMi2xAvwk
transaction
e96509b607e707f262d526d46b06750125da2e5795ae58ae1add9ab8fa4bc495
spent
true